Trump: We’ll strike Iran more violently next week
US President Donald Trump said Friday that strikes on Iran will be the most violent next week, and that the war will end when he feels it in his bones!
This came in response to questions about the Iran during an interview with journalist Brian Kilmeade of radio Fox News.
On the timing of the end of the US attacks on Iran in cooperation with Israel, Trump hinted that the process would not take long.
Asked “How do you know when the war with Iran will end?” Trump replied: “I don’t think it’s going to take long… It’ll end when I feel it in my bones”.
Trump said that he trusted his own intuition, adding that the attacks on Iran had caused significant damage to its military capabilities…
“We’ll beat them more violently next week… The regime in Iran will fall, but maybe not too soon,” he added.
When asked about the situation of Iran’s new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ei, the son of former Supreme Leader Ali Khamenei, who was assassinated in a US-Israeli attack, Trump referred to his injuries.
He explained that Mojtaba Khamenei wasn’t appointed by his father to the position of commander.
“They ask if he is alive… Many are trying to figure it out… I think he’s alive but he’s injured”.
On the other hand, Trump indicated that Russian President Vladimir Putin may be providing a little help to Iran.
On the possibility of a military operation to control enriched uranium in Iran, he replied: “No, there is no such thing… At the moment we aren’t focusing on that, but we may focus on the future”.
